River landscape and cityscape in Sioux Falls

Falls Park is a central reason to visit Sioux Falls. Several viewpoints offer perspectives of the namesake falls; there is also a five-story observation tower. The Big Sioux River is not merely a geographical reference but also shapes the city’s landscape impression.

Downtown around Phillips Avenue provides an urban counterpoint. This area combines restaurants, terraces, and live music to create a vibrant cityscape. SculptureWalk adds an annual changing exhibition of public sculptures to the cultural experience. Season and road travel

The impression created by the falls changes with the amount of water and the temperature. Anyone interested in wintry ice formations can consider the cold season as a distinct option for visiting Falls Park. However, this remains a possible seasonal observation and is not a guarantee of specific winter conditions.

For road travel, Sioux Falls can be oriented by its location on Interstates 29 and 90. If you are traveling by car, you can use these road connections to place the city within your route planning, without deriving specific travel times or parking options from them.
